> Interesting. Hypothesising, wouldn't it be better if compiling to metal
> happened already during installation?

Nice idea for hand-helds for sure.  In a big computing environments,
the situation is trickier.  For example, a network storage device may
contain the intermediate code installation used by many and varied
client machines.  Each client may load and finish compilation
differently over fast local networks.  Your idea might still be a
meaningful head start to the process even in that case.
